Transaction 8df8c90d46a63e13c14bd54359e7633aeb43cd94fae0080a451b43f7ab23d113

19 Input
1 Outputs
  • 8df8c90d46a63e13c14bd54359e7633aeb43cd94fae0080a451b43f7ab23d113:0
  • value  287967566
    address  3EwHEyU2zwM53Gv7c6HEXE3vKWrzryqckv